In the here and now they are trading blows. I would go with a RX480 for no other reason than Kepler and Maxwell's history of not lasting as long as GCN. Performance atm might just be in the gtx1060's favor but really there is nothing in it.
 
I've often read rather negative reports from review sites of the Nitro. Not just one guy saying his is just great, but detailed reviews saying it isn't so good. What makes you recommend the Nitro?

I've got one and it's taken everything I've thrown at it at 1080p. I have a PC behind my TV stand (Nitro set to 1348/2150) and the noise of the Nitro on full is way quieter than my PS4.

The only problems I've had are with the new Deus Ex on DX12, crashes a lot. DX11 is easily hitting 60fps with most settings on full or thereabouts.
